Two Ways To Add Instant Curb Appeal To Your Home



There are tons of things that you can do to add some curb appeal to your home. Today we are going to be talking about two ways in which we can do this for a fairly cheap price and in a fairly short amount of time. Before we begin our discussion we need to first define what curb appeal is and why it is important to your home.

The definition of curb appeal can pretty much be summed up as the first impression that a potential buyer gets from the street of the exterior and the interior through the windows of your house. This is important for two reasons. The first obviously is that you are trying to sell your home; we all know how important first impressions are don’t we. The second is that it will give you a much higher home value when it comes time to sell it.

Now onto the first thing that can add some instant curb appeal outdoor lighting. Outdoor lighting will make your house instantly pop out in ways that many others will not. This is the case because it can be seen at night while others cannot. Installing sconces near your door and along the path to your door set a great night time mood that is hard to recreate any way else. Outdoor sconce lighting is also a great way to help detour burglars and robbers from breaking into your home. Wrought iron outdoor chandeliers are also great if you have a gazebo that can be seen from the road. They provide just enough light to see inside of the gazebo but do not light up the whole backyard and break the mood like spot lights do.

The next thing that you can do to add instant curb appeal is to install shrubs and trees in your yard. Adding these things says to the potential home buyer that you care about your yard and home and have put time and effort into making it look its best. This also says that you have probably kept up with the repairs of the house because most people who take of their yards also take care of their houses as well. If you are not able to cut your grass every week, have your landscaper or you yourself cut the grass as low as possible so that the weeds and grass don’t grow to tall.
